I have been a (right-handed) recurve shooter since I started with archery, and I have recently got a Baraga with locator grip. I am almost completely recovered from a shoulder injury and, while I am not strong enough to shoo the bow yet, I have been exercising drawing the bow. I think I will be ready to shoot it (strengthwise) in a couple of weeks at most.
This is my question: I have noticed that when I am at full draw, the shelf is not parallel to the direction of shooting, but it is slightly obliquous: the edge on the belly (i.e. closer to me) goes on the left, while the one on the back (i.e. the edge toward the target) points right.
